Eliza went to the store and bought 3 lbs of apples at $1.99 per lb, two loaves of bread at $.89 per loaf, a box of cereal at $3.

99 per box, and a gallon of milk at $3.19 per gallon. If Eliza paid with $20, how much change did she receive?
Mathematics
1 answer:
alexandr1967 [171]2 years ago
6 0
<h2>Answer:</h2>

The amount of change she will receive is:

                           $ 5.07

<h2>Step-by-step explanation:</h2>
  • Eliza bought 3 lbs of apples at $1.99 per lb.

This means that cost of 3 lbs of apple= $ (1.99×3)

i.e. cost of 3 lbs of apple= $ 5.97

  • Two loaves of bread at $.89 per loaf.

Cost of 2 loaves= $ (0.89×2)

i.e.

Cost of 2 loaves= $ 1.78

  • A box of cereal at $3.99 per box.
  • Cost of one gallon of milk at $3.19 per gallon.

This means that the total cost of his purchase is:

$ (5.97+1.78+3.99+3.19)

= $ 14.93

If Eliza paid with $20.

This means that the change she will receive is:

= $ (20-14.93)

= $ 5.07
